The Road To Kubernetes: How Older Technologies Add Up
Kubernetes on the backend used to utilize docker for much of its container runtime solutions. One of the modular features of Kubernetes is the ability to utilize a Container Runtime Interface or CRI. The problem was that Docker didn't really meet the spec properly and they had to maintain a shim to translate properly. Instead users could utilize the popular containerd or cri-o runtimes. These follow the Open Container Initiative or OCI's guidelines on container formats.

Docker is deleting Open Source organisations - what you need to know
Alternatives like Podman and CRI-O continue to gain traction and may replace Docker in various places. For example, Kubernetes used to use Docker, then moved to containerd, and now also support CRI-O. Generally speaking, the core features of "Docker" are such a commodity now that no one was the wiser when Kubernetes stopped using it.

Container Deep Dive 2: Container Engines
The CRI-O container engine provides a stable, more secure, and performant platform for running Open Container Initiative (OCI) compatible runtimes. CRI-Os purpose is to be the container engine that implements the Kubernetes Container Runtime Interface (CRI) for OpenShift Container Platform and Kubernetes, replacing the Docker service. Source
